About Potassium Fluorosilicate

Potassium fluorosilicate (potassium hexafluorosilicate, K2SiF6, CAS 16871-90-2) is an inorganic salt consisting of potassium cations and hexafluorosilicate anions. It is produced by reacting fluorosilicic acid (H2SiF6) with potassium chloride or potassium carbonate, followed by crystallization and drying.

The commercial product is a white, free-flowing crystalline powder with low solubility in water (approximately 0.12 g/100 mL at 20°C). It decomposes upon heating above 300°C, releasing silicon tetrafluoride (SiF4) and leaving potassium fluoride. Potassium fluorosilicate is primarily used in glass and ceramic manufacturing, where it serves as a fluxing agent and opacifier.

Applications

Glass Manufacturing

Fluxing and fining agent in glass production, particularly for opal glass, frosted glass, and specialty glass products. Potassium fluorosilicate lowers melting temperature and improves glass clarity by removing bubbles. Typical addition rate is 0.5-2.0% by batch weight. Used in the production of glass fibers, optical glass, and laboratory glassware.

Ceramics & Enamels

Flux and opacifier in ceramic glazes, frits, and porcelain enamels. Potassium fluorosilicate promotes vitrification, reduces firing temperature, and improves glaze hardness and chemical resistance. Used in wall tile, sanitary ware, and tableware glazes. Typical dosage is 1-5% in glaze formulations.

Electroplating & Metal Treatment

Component in electroplating baths for zinc, nickel, and chromium plating. Potassium fluorosilicate improves plating uniformity, brightness, and corrosion resistance of deposits. Also used in metal surface treatment, conversion coatings, and anodizing baths for aluminum and magnesium alloys.

Wood Preservation

Active ingredient in wood preservative formulations for protection against fungal decay and insect attack. Potassium fluorosilicate is used in pressure treatment and dip treatment processes for utility poles, railway ties, and construction timber. Often formulated with other preservatives for broad-spectrum protection.

Other Uses

Raw material for production of potassium fluoride and hydrofluoric acid, additive in welding fluxes and soldering agents, catalyst in organic synthesis, and component in abrasive products. Also used in the manufacture of fireproofing materials and specialty chemicals.

Storage & Handling

Store in a cool, dry, ventilated area in tightly sealed containers. Keep away from moisture, acids, and food products. Potassium fluorosilicate is stable under normal storage conditions but may release toxic fumes when heated or in contact with strong acids. Use corrosion-resistant equipment (stainless steel, HDPE, or glass-lined). Shelf life is 24 months under proper storage conditions.

Wear protective gloves, safety glasses, and dust mask when handling. Avoid inhalation of dust and prolonged skin contact. Potassium fluorosilicate is toxic if ingested and may cause skin and eye irritation. In case of eye contact, flush with water for 15 minutes and seek medical attention. Do not use in food contact applications without appropriate regulatory approval.

Frequently Asked Questions

Is potassium fluorosilicate the same as sodium fluorosilicate?

No. Potassium fluorosilicate (K2SiF6) and sodium fluorosilicate (Na2SiF6) are different salts with different solubility, melting behavior, and application profiles. Potassium fluorosilicate has lower water solubility and is preferred in certain glass and ceramic applications. They are not always interchangeable.

Can potassium fluorosilicate be used in food contact materials?

Potassium fluorosilicate is not approved for direct food contact in most jurisdictions. It may be used in manufacturing processes for glass and ceramics that subsequently become food contact materials, but residual fluoride levels must meet applicable regulatory limits. Verify with your local regulatory authority.
